Transaction 527f1fa4a156da5a8b17024a37374edccf233aab1426d3730414eb1167bdd466

1 Input
2 Outputs
  • 527f1fa4a156da5a8b17024a37374edccf233aab1426d3730414eb1167bdd466:0
  • value  8032095
    address  3FT3uKNypwgZKEnQTwi38BcGYvVLqb3Rgv
  • 527f1fa4a156da5a8b17024a37374edccf233aab1426d3730414eb1167bdd466:1
  • value  80499848
    address  3Ktaf4PYLRNoQKvMA8oBRqQjyhyBKgeJg7